Question 1: A patient weighing 70 kg requires a drug at 5 mg/kg/day in two divided doses. What is each dose?
- 175 mg (Correct answer)
- 350 mg
- 87.5 mg
- 140 mg
Correct answer: 175 mg
Total daily dose = 70 ร 5 = 350 mg. Divided into 2 doses: 350 รท 2 = 175 mg per dose.
Question 2: An infusion of 500 mg in 250 mL is running at 50 mL/hour. What is the rate in mg/hour?
- 100 mg/hour (Correct answer)
- 50 mg/hour
- 200 mg/hour
- 25 mg/hour
Correct answer: 100 mg/hour
Concentration = 500/250 = 2 mg/mL. Rate = 2 mg/mL ร 50 mL/hour = 100 mg/hour.
Question 3: Which excipient acts as a preservative in multi-dose eye drops?
- Benzalkonium chloride (Correct answer)
- Hydroxypropyl methylcellulose
- Sodium chloride
- Povidone
Correct answer: Benzalkonium chloride
Benzalkonium chloride (BAC) is the most commonly used preservative in multi-dose ophthalmic preparations. It prevents microbial contamination.
Question 4: What is the purpose of an enteric coating on a tablet?
- To prevent dissolution in gastric acid (Correct answer)
- To mask unpleasant taste
- To improve appearance
- To speed up drug release
Correct answer: To prevent dissolution in gastric acid
Enteric coatings resist gastric acid and dissolve in the higher pH of the small intestine, protecting acid-labile drugs or preventing gastric irritation.

Question 6: Which property of a drug most influences its ability to cross the blood-brain barrier?
- Lipophilicity (Correct answer)
- Molecular weight only
- Protein binding
- Renal clearance
Correct answer: Lipophilicity
Lipophilic (fat-soluble) drugs cross the blood-brain barrier more readily because the barrier is composed mainly of lipid bilayer membranes.
